Note that here, Eigen::Matrix2f is only used as an example, more generally the issue arises for all \ref TopicFixedSizeVectorizable "fixed-size vectorizable Eigen types" and \ref TopicStructHavingEigenMembers "structures having such Eigen objects as member".
+The same issue will be exhibited by any classes/functions by-passing operator new to allocate memory, that is, by performing custom memory allocation followed by calls to the placement new operator. This is for instance typically the case of \c std::make_shared or \c std::allocate_shared for which is the solution is to use an \ref aligned_allocator "aligned allocator" as detailed in the \ref TopicStlContainers "solution for STL containers".
